A Midwestern Gay Boys Story is an answer to many questions that have been asked about what it was like to be gay in the Midwestern U.S. from the late 1950s until the present. The author addresses many of the attitudes towards how people were treated who were LGBTQ+, long before the acronym was even created. There were many dangers, threats, and constantly living in fear, shame, guilt, and terror of being discovered for who you are. Even though it did not affect the author, personally, there were many LGBTQ+ people who lost their lives, families, and jobs/careers simply for being who they are. These are about personal struggles and becoming who the author truly is. Not everyone can relate, yet there are some who can. If this can help give you a voice, or a talking point to start your life authentically, then it has been worth it.
